DeepSeek

deepseek-recipe

English | 中文

deepseek-recipe is a collection of Rust libraries and Python bindings that uniformly convert API requests in different formats into the Conversation format, encode them into prompts for DeepSeek models, and convert model output into responses in the corresponding format. Use these components to connect an inference backend to API services that support multiple formats. Model inference, tool execution, and HTTP transport must be provided externally.

Supported scope

  • Request/response formats: Conversion of Messages, Chat Completions, and Responses requests, Streaming response, and complete responses. Supports text, images, thinking, and client tool calls.
  • Prompts: Encoding of DeepSeek V4 and V4.1 conversations into prompts or token IDs.
  • Generation settings: Thinking mode, reasoning effort, temperature, top_p, and output token limits.
  • Output parsing: Thinking, tool calls, JSON object output, and stop sequences.
  • Images: Provided as base64 or external URLs. The image component provides DeepSeek V4.1 preprocessing with OpenCV.
  • Tool definitions: Function tools; the Responses API also supports tool namespaces and the apply_patch custom tool.

Not yet supported

  • Token probabilities (logprobs and top_logprobs).
  • Document content, audio/video input, and file retrieval by file_id.
  • Server tool execution, such as web_search.
  • JSON Schema and regex output constraints, or enforcement of tool strict settings.
  • Multiple completions per Chat Completions request (n > 1).
  • Responses custom tool definitions other than apply_patch.
  • Responses conversation storage and context retrieval through previous_response_id.
  • Responses encrypted thinking content (encrypted_content).

Using deepseek-recipe

To convert a Chat Completions request into a DeepSeek V4.1 prompt:

Python

Installation

Python 3.10+:

python3 -m pip install deepseek-recipe

Example

from deepseek_recipe import ChatCompletionRequest, ConversionOptions, DeepseekV41Encoding

request = ChatCompletionRequest({
    "model": "deepseek-flash",
    "messages": [{"role": "user", "content": "Hello"}],
})
converted = request.convert(ConversionOptions())
rendered = DeepseekV41Encoding().render_conversation(converted.conversation)
print(rendered.prompt)

Rust

Installation

cargo add deepseek-recipe@0.1 deepseek-recipe-encoding@0.1

See the development guide for source builds and image dependencies.

Example

use deepseek_recipe::openai::ChatCompletionRequest;
use deepseek_recipe::request::{ConversionOptions, ProtocolRequest};
use deepseek_recipe_encoding::PromptEncoding;
use deepseek_recipe_encoding::v4::dsv41::DeepseekV41Encoding;
use serde_json::json;

fn main() -> Result<(), Box<dyn std::error::Error>> {
    let request: ChatCompletionRequest = serde_json::from_value(json!({
        "model": "deepseek-flash",
        "messages": [{"role": "user", "content": "Hello"}],
    }))?;
    let converted = request.convert(ConversionOptions::default())?;
    let rendered = DeepseekV41Encoding::new().render_conversation(&converted.conversation);
    println!("{}", rendered.prompt);
    Ok(())
}

Packages and example projects

PackagePurpose
deepseek-recipeProtocol conversion and model output parsing.
deepseek-recipe-coreShared conversation, message, image, and tool types.
deepseek-recipe-encodingDeepSeek V4 and V4.1 prompt rendering and token encoding.
deepseek-recipe-imageImage fetching and preprocessing.
deepseek-recipe-pythonPython bindings, imported as deepseek_recipe.
encoding-decoding-demoA web interface for encoding prompts, inspecting special tokens, and decoding complete model output into Chat Completions, Responses, or Messages.
server-rsAn Axum API example with mock inference.
server-pyA FastAPI example with mock inference.
